A pair of children's chairs from northern China, made from hardwood — presumably elm (Yumu) — and modelled on the form of the traditional Official's Hat Chair, scaled down with care rather than abbreviation. The characteristic yoke-back profile is fully present, as is the carved circular medallion set into each back splat. The seats are constructed with an inserted panel within a frame-and-filling structure, and the joints throughout are traditional slot-and-peg connections secured with wooden dowels — no nails, no adhesive. An ink inscription in Chinese characters (Huizi) is written on the underside of each chair, likely an ownership or workshop mark. The wood has aged to a deep, reddish-brown tone with an uneven surface that records years of use without apology. Sold as a pair.
